We raised a grand total of £447.00!

We held it in aid of Tabitha's Toys (click the link for more info), a little girl who sadly had Edwards Syndrome, and her parents set up the charity to provide sensory toys for children with complex disabilities in the north east, free of charge.
So the money we raised will go towards more sensory toys and equipment :)

I love my little white ornaments, i made them from baking soda clay, which is basically cornflour, baking soda and water, then heated in a pot and stirred until it forms a ball
